Recipe Card

Servings: 10 slices Prep Time: 10 minutes Cook Time: 55 minutes Total Time: 1 hour 5 minutes

Ingredients

For the Banana Bread:

  • 3 ripe bananas (mashed, about 1 ¼ cups)

  • ½ c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, melted

  • ¾ cup brown sugar

  • 2 large eggs

  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

  • 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our

  • 1 teaspoon baking soda

  • ½ teaspoon salt

  • ½ teaspoon cinnamon (optional, but delicious)

Optional Add-Ins:

  • ½ cup chopped walnuts or pecans

  • ½ cup chocolate chips

  • ¼ cup sour cream or Greek yogurt (for extra moistness)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F. Grease and flour a 9x5-inch loaf pan or line it with parchment paper.

  2. Mix Wet Ingredients: In a large bowl, whisk together mashed bananas, melted butter, and brown sugar until smooth. Add eggs and vanilla extract, and mix until combined.

  3. Add Dry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on. Gently fold the dry ingredients into the banana mixture until just combined — don’t overmix!

  4. Add Mix-Ins (Optional): Fold in nuts, chocolate chips, or any add-ins you like.

  5. Bake the Bread: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an. Bake for 50–60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.

  6. Cool and Serve: Let the banana bread c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ack. Slice, serve, and enjoy warm or at room temperature.

Tips for the Best Banana Bread

  • Use very ripe bananas — the more speckled and soft, the sweeter and more flavorful your bread will be.

  • Don’t overmix the batter — it keeps your banana bread tender and soft.

  • For extra moistness, add a spoonful of sour cream or Greek yogurt to the batter.

  • Sprinkle a few chocolate chips or sliced bananas on top before baking for a pretty finish.

  • Wrap leftovers tightly — banana bread stays moist for days and tastes even better the next day!
